November 9, 1938: The November Pogroms and Their Aftermath

On-site

The event focuses on the November Pogroms 1938 in Berlin, often reduced to the image of burning synagogues. This time, the emphasis is on the subsequent escalation: the mass arrests of Jewish men, their deportation to concentration camps, and the Nazi regime's attempt to force the Jewish population into emigration through intimidation and extortion. Using recent research and biographical case studies, the dynamics of this wave of repression are made visible.

This event is organized by the Freundeskreis Yad Vashem Berlin. The expert speaker is historian Dr. Susanne Heim, whose research focuses on persecution and forced emigration. Further panelists have been invited.
